What is a Lean-To Conservatory?
A lean-to conservatory, also called a Mediterranean conservatory, features a minimalist structure characterized by its sloping roof that raids a wall of the main building. Its simple design enables simple integration into existing homes, making it an appealing choice for those aiming to extend their living space.

Replacing an old lean-to conservatory brings a plethora of benefits, consisting of:
Improved Aesthetics: New designs can enhance the overall appearance of your home, making it more aesthetically appealing.
Increased Functionality: Upgrading allows you to tailor the area according to your current way of life needs-- maybe turning it into a home workplace or an additional living room.
Energy Efficiency: Modern materials and insulation techniques can significantly improve heating and cooling performance, lowering energy bills.
Boosted Value: A new conservatory can increase the market worth of your residential or commercial property, making it more attractive to prospective buyers.
Better Durability: New materials provide improved durability and require less upkeep with time than older structures.
